Triplanar
Python: "map_triplanar"
The triplanar node is similar to a box mapping texture projection, but with the ability to blend each side projection at the edges to conceal the seams. Additionally, it is possible to project a different map at each side.

Main¶
Same input for all sides¶
Python: "map_triplanar_same_input"
If enabled, the X axis input color/texture will be used for the Y and Z axes. This may be useful to create a seamless mapping from just one texture easily.

Blend¶
Python: "map_triplanar_blend"
Conceals the projection seams by blending the three triplanar projections by the given amount.
